Handover note — Crumbwheel order cutoffs.

Welcome aboard. The bakery cutoff rule in Crumbwheel closes same-day orders at 14:00 local to each storefront, not UTC — this has bitten us twice. Holiday overrides live in the calendar service and take precedence silently, so always check there first when a cutoff looks wrong. To unlock the calendar service's admin console after a restart, enter the recovery passphrase below.

vault phrase of bagap-bahaf = silion-pelox-sorox-casdor-quenwyn-fraax-eliox-praael-kelion-quenvan-kasox-rusael-norius-belvan

Handover note — Veldt validator plugin system

From Orin to whoever maintains Veldt next: the plugin loader discovers validators under the `veldt-checks` namespace and sandboxes them with the Hollowgate runtime. Third-party plugins must declare their schema version or they are quarantined. The registry signing key lives in the Ashvault; rotation is quarterly and the next one is due soon. If the Ashvault session expires mid-rotation, do not regenerate the key — recover the existing one with the passphrase that follows below.

recovery phrase for kajop-yagef: istael-ulaius

Quarterly Planning Note — Subscription Tier Launch

Finance team: the new Lumeris "Summit" tier launches in Q3. Pricing set at a 60% premium over Plus; margin modelling assumes 8% uptake in year one. Revenue recognition follows existing deferred schedules. Billing system changes land by mid-quarter; provisioning costs are in the capex line. Questions to the planning channel. Confidential rationale follows below.

confidential, fajop-fajef: Soriusax Foods plans to lower the Rusix list price by 43.2 percent in December. The steering committee signed off on a budget of $74.0 million for Project Oliion. The renewal with Brivanix Works closes at $118.6 million a year, 43.4 percent above the last contract. Project Ulaiel slips by six weeks because of the audit delay.